<p><i>Wilhelm Von Orange</i> a heroic poem by Albert Schulz and Albert Wolfram presents a stirring narrative in the German language. Published in 1873 this epic work celebrates the deeds and legacy of William of Orange. The poem rich in historical detail and evocative language offers a glimpse into the heroic ideals and literary traditions of the 19th century. Readers interested in German poetry historical narratives and epic literature will find <i>Wilhelm Von Orange</i> a compelling and rewarding read. The work showcases the authors' skill in crafting verses that bring to life a significant figure in European history.
